Rapsodo Mobile Launch Monitor

Portable launch monitor for indoor and outdoor use

Overview

Rapsodo Mobile Launch Monitor uses your iPhone or iPad to capture ball speed, club speed, launch angle, and spin. It offers session replay with video overlay and GPS satellite view for outdoor practice. I found the app intuitive and quick to set up. It is ideal for players who want accurate numbers without bulky gear.

This device pairs with iOS only. For those seeking the best golf tracking software paired to a launch monitor, Rapsodo delivers pro-level metrics in a compact package. It fits practice bays and home simulators well.

Overview

Voice Caddie SC200Plus is a portable launch monitor that reports ball speed, club speed, and distance. It has a built-in speaker for instant voice feedback and long battery life for full sessions. The device is compact and easy to place behind shots. I liked the clear readouts and simple menus.

While not a full software suite, it pairs with apps for deeper analysis. For golfers seeking focused metrics and quick feedback, Voice Caddie is among the best golf tracking software adjuncts that deliver fast numbers on the go.
